Como mover blogs em WordPress, parte 1

Recentemente, movi vários dos meus blogs e sites, uns para outro servidor, outros para outro domínio, e, no caso de outros, ambos em simultâneo.

Isto não é, felizmente, uma coisa que se faz com frequência, mas pode ser necessário, ocasionalmente.

O que se segue refere-se especificamente a blogs em WordPress, num servidor próprio, a correr Apache.

Ah, convém sempre fazer backups de tudo antes de começar. :)

1- mudança de servidor, mantendo o endereço

O processo é relativamente simples: copia-se todos os ficheiros da directoria do blog para o sítio correspondente no novo servidor. Faz-se dump da base de dados (mysqldump -u user -p basededados > basededados.sql , substituindo os parâmetros óbvios), importa-se a mesma para o MySQL do novo servidor, e faz-se a mudança no DNS. Quando esta se propagar, os pedidos deverão passar a ir para o novo servidor em vez do antigo, de forma totalmente transparente.

2- mudança de endereço, mantendo o servidor

Ir ao painel de administração do blog, e, nos campos de endereço, mudar o mesmo para o novo. Imediatamente, perde-se o acesso ao blog até ele estar no sítio certo, o que se faz de seguida no Apache (com um novo virtual host, por exemplo, ou movendo tudo para uma nova directoria). Quando estiver no sítio, é só ir ao novo endereço, e o blog deverá lá estar.

Ver a parte 2, relativa a redireccionamentos.

3- mudança de endereço e de servidor

No fundo, não é mais do que uma mistura dos anteriores. Ir ao painel de administração, mudar o endereço, copiar os ficheiros para o novo sítio no novo servidor, fazer dump da base de dados, importá-la no MySQL do novo servidor, e pronto.

Mais uma vez, ver a parte 2: redireccionamentos. Essa parte será escrita amanhã. :)

1 Response to “Como mover blogs em WordPress, parte 1”


  1. 1 dextro

    Já tive de fazer isso tudo infelizmente e só tenho uma sugestão bem grande a fazer: BACKUP e muita atenção á ordem como se faz a mudança: deve-se mudar primeiro o url nas opções e depois a localização dos ficheiros e não ao contrario caso contrario vai ser necessario alteral manualmente o URL na base de dados e isso é sempre complicado :?

Leave a Reply

Citar o texto seleccionado





Bad Behavior has blocked 348 access attempts in the last 7 days.

Attribution-NonCommercial-NoDerivs 2.5
Attribution-NonCommercial-NoDerivs 2.5